Transaction fd3a60731fe57b60024a12f08351688df5b922ab587a94a635f8a36a137eb564
1 Input
1 Output
-
fd3a60731fe57b60024a12f08351688df5b922ab587a94a635f8a36a137eb564:0
- value
- 43629397
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ff68897103b705c26887ca42957e0840f760758c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QHUYGTirwYjbAUSG8ur1MiRPknFN3MQQj